What is an associate instructor?

Associate Instructors are individuals, often graduate students or early-career educators, who assist with teaching responsibilities at colleges or universities. Their roles may include leading discussion sections, grading assignments, holding office hours, and sometimes delivering lectures under the supervision of a lead instructor or professor. Associate Instructors play a vital role in supporting student learning and contributing to the overall teaching mission of the institution. They often gain valuable teaching experience that can help them in future academic or educational careers.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be an associate instructor?

To thrive as an Associate Instructor, you generally need subject matter expertise, a relevant degree, and teaching or instructional experience.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), digital presentation tools, and classroom technology is typically required. Strong communication, adaptability, and interpersonal skills help foster an engaging learning environment and support diverse student needs. These skills and qualifications are essential for delivering effective instruction, promoting student success, and maintaining a dynamic classroom atmosphere.

How to become an associate instructor?

To become an associate instructor, candidates typically need a relevant educational background, such as a bachelor's degree, and may be required to demonstrate teaching skills or subject matter expertise. Some positions also require prior experience, certifications, or training in instructional methods. Applying through institutional job portals and completing any necessary interviews or assessments are common steps in the process.

The Aviation Institute of Maintenance (AIM), established in 1969, is a premier institution dedicated to advancing the field of aviation maintenance through exceptional education and training. With 15 campuses nationwide, AIM is a cornerstone in the aviation industry, accounting for 20% of all students attending FAA-certified Airframe & Powerplant (A&P) schools across the country. Each year, AIM proudly contributes to the graduation of nearly one in four certified aircraft technicians in America.
